A video on YouTube from Thai Rath showed the snake catchers from the Krabi Phitak Pracha foundation get to grips with a five meter long King Cobra. The snake had scared patrons at the Ban Suan Khao Khram restaurant who were all waiting outside when the foundation team arrived. It took only 20 minutes for the experts to bag the beast who had taken up temporary residence in the kitchen. It was reckoned to be about a 15 year old specimen.
